    One problem is that there's at least 8 different jump distances, depending on the time between W and Space key activation. I did some testing with a keyboard macro to precisely set the time in milliseconds and measure the jump distance, taking a screen shot of each.
    Here's the result:
    My character started on the rail at the bottom each time. The only way to deal with this is to develop a feel for the timing.
